Shunned by everyone she knows because of her unfortunate grey eyes, Tragic Storm is used to being alone. Yet, her best friend is a six foot, two hundred pound golden king with five inch claws. Her protector and her beloved companion in the complex land along the Zambezi River, Anesu the lion is the only one seen among her people to accept a human into the misunderstood world of lions. Known as holder of storms and keeper of the lions in her village, the young woman struggles to find her own identity. Together, they will run away, become acquainted with other inhabitants of the land [both friend and foe], test dangerous waters, and face death. Perhaps she will even find love...Stormy's journey leads her closer to God and makes her aware of the growing strength and beauty inside of her, as she and Anesu will brave their African kingdom of Zimbabwe.
